Brawl creator hopes to work on "different genres" in future

The current issue of Japanese gaming magazine Famitsu includes an extensive interview with Super Smash Bros. Brawl director Masahiro Sakurai, in which he discusses his pleasure at the eclectic fighter's success, as well as his hopes for the direction of his own firm, Sora Ltd.
